Set in a cute terrace house, this home by the seaside offers a peaceful break to those looking to take a short trip on the Suffolk coastline. As you enter the house, you'll be warmly greeted by the open-plan kitchen and living area, which along with the bedrooms and bathroom upstairs, are delicately dressed in contemporary designs and soft furnishings. When the weather is kind, there's also an outdoor space at the back of the home where you can soak up the sunshine. However, the local beaches at Thorpeness and Southwold offer a more exciting way to lap up some vitamin D. Enjoy the great British seaside experience with fish and chips by the sea, or why not explore the local Suffolk coastline and surrounding countryside on two wheels? If you're bringing your bikes, there are gates giving access to the neighbouring properties where you can store bikes at the back of the house.

About Suffolk
Seaside towns with pastel Victorian villas, a rambling coastline with clifftop walks, and undulating countryside studded with stately homes is what Suffolk is all about. In Southwold, a Victorian pier juts out into the sea and the smell of fresh fish and chips floats on the sea air. Explore Snape Maltings
A cultural hub with an excellent auditorium, art galleries, and independent shops. Enjoy a walk along the river and indulge in a delicious meal at the lovely cafe.

Experience Aldeburgh Cinema
Immerse yourself in the nostalgic charm of this community cinema dating back to 1919. Enjoy arthouse and mainstream films in a comfy interior within the beautiful seaside town of Aldeburgh.
